android模擬器判斷 安卓模擬器實(shí)現(xiàn)原理

請教怎么判斷設(shè)備是否是android的模擬器

1、識別的方法如下。獲取藍(lán)牙名稱。模擬器的藍(lán)牙名稱大多數(shù)為null。測試光傳感器。一般的按住設(shè)備都有光線傳感器,模擬器是沒有的。測試CPU類型。手機(jī)是arm架構(gòu),模擬器基本是intel和amd兩種??梢垣@取藍(lán)牙名稱,模擬器基本為null。

作為一家“創(chuàng)意+整合+營銷”的成都網(wǎng)站建設(shè)機(jī)構(gòu),我們在業(yè)內(nèi)良好的客戶口碑。創(chuàng)新互聯(lián)提供從前期的網(wǎng)站品牌分析策劃、網(wǎng)站設(shè)計(jì)、做網(wǎng)站、成都網(wǎng)站設(shè)計(jì)、創(chuàng)意表現(xiàn)、網(wǎng)頁制作、系統(tǒng)開發(fā)以及后續(xù)網(wǎng)站營銷運(yùn)營等一系列服務(wù),幫助企業(yè)打造創(chuàng)新的互聯(lián)網(wǎng)品牌經(jīng)營模式與有效的網(wǎng)絡(luò)營銷方法,創(chuàng)造更大的價值。

2、經(jīng)過在各個模擬器上測試,發(fā)現(xiàn)大多數(shù)都是可以檢測出來的,只有各別模擬器不可以檢測出來,其中包括“夜神安卓模擬器”。

3、測試光傳感器。一般的按住設(shè)備都有光線傳感器,模擬器是沒有的。測試CPU類型。手機(jī)是arm架構(gòu),模擬器基本是intel和amd兩種。

4、首先要明白 不要采用IMEI的方式。模擬器的IMEI可以修改的。而且平板是沒有IMEI的,可以檢測設(shè)備的MAC地址,模擬器的MAC地址是固定的幾種。

5、android.os.Build.MODEL :獲取手機(jī)的型號 設(shè)備名稱。如果發(fā)現(xiàn)Landroid/os/Build;-MODEL 為sdk,則為模擬器上運(yùn)行。

6、,android_id String android_id = Secure.getString(getContentResolver(), Secure.ANDROID_ID);設(shè)備和模擬器都有,16位。

尷尬!鴻蒙OS遭軟件誤判斷Android模擬器,更多應(yīng)用深度適配中

據(jù)參與測試的用戶反映,鴻蒙OS系統(tǒng)軟件生態(tài)的完成性較高,軟件打開速度相比基于Android10深度適配的EMUI11更快一些,使用中很少會出現(xiàn)Bug和異?,F(xiàn)象,不過這些軟件目前剛剛適配鴻蒙OS,功能層面可能存在一些差異,未來逐漸完善使用。

據(jù)我所知,目前沒有任何權(quán)威檢測軟件適配harmonyOS。當(dāng)初國產(chǎn)內(nèi)存喝芯片剛開賣的時候,各大權(quán)威軟件也沒適配導(dǎo)致識別錯誤。其次鴻蒙兼容安卓應(yīng)用,應(yīng)用本身就是安卓的,不是harmony版本的。

第一就是升級鴻蒙后軟件出現(xiàn)閃退問題,第二便是功耗問題。

app如何識別是安卓設(shè)備,還是安卓模擬器的?

識別的方法如下。獲取藍(lán)牙名稱。模擬器的藍(lán)牙名稱大多數(shù)為null。測試光傳感器。一般的按住設(shè)備都有光線傳感器,模擬器是沒有的。測試CPU類型。手機(jī)是arm架構(gòu),模擬器基本是intel和amd兩種??梢垣@取藍(lán)牙名稱,模擬器基本為null。

識別的方法如下。獲取藍(lán)牙名稱。模擬器的藍(lán)牙名稱大多數(shù)為null。測試光傳感器。一般的按住設(shè)備都有光線傳感器,模擬器是沒有的。測試CPU類型。手機(jī)是arm架構(gòu),模擬器基本是intel和amd兩種。

軟件的區(qū)分方法較多,不局限于幾種不同的屬性,但一般都是大量屬性來確定的,如陀螺儀,有些還會看海拔信息,但一般的都較為簡單,都會查看IMEI信息等設(shè)備號。

有基于模擬器特征和api返回值的檢測方法都可以通過修改安卓源碼的方式輕松繞過。模擬器與真機(jī)的本質(zhì)區(qū)別在于運(yùn)行載體。

讓APP識別不出是模擬器的方法如下:對APP進(jìn)行反編譯,把源碼調(diào)出來,找到檢測模擬器的那些代碼進(jìn)行邏輯更改,使APP返回給服務(wù)器的信息為真實(shí)手機(jī),這樣就可以繞過檢測了,不過這都是需要專業(yè)人士操作的,一般人無法操作。

,android_id String android_id = Secure.getString(getContentResolver(), Secure.ANDROID_ID);設(shè)備和模擬器都有,16位。

如何檢測是否是android模擬器

識別的方法如下。獲取藍(lán)牙名稱。模擬器的藍(lán)牙名稱大多數(shù)為null。測試光傳感器。一般的按住設(shè)備都有光線傳感器,模擬器是沒有的。測試CPU類型。手機(jī)是arm架構(gòu),模擬器基本是intel和amd兩種??梢垣@取藍(lán)牙名稱,模擬器基本為null。

經(jīng)過在各個模擬器上測試,發(fā)現(xiàn)大多數(shù)都是可以檢測出來的,只有各別模擬器不可以檢測出來,其中包括“夜神安卓模擬器”。

可以測試光傳感器,模擬器是不能模擬的。測試CPU類型,手機(jī)正常的是arm架構(gòu)的,而電腦基本是intel和amd兩種。不同廠商自己的方式。

基于這一點(diǎn),可以設(shè)計(jì)一段CPU任務(wù)調(diào)度程序來檢測模擬器 。具體的你可以參鑒DexLab上的一篇文章。當(dāng)然,這個方法也是可以被繞過的,可以在理解qemu源碼的基礎(chǔ)上,修改qemu源碼,但很明顯這個門檻很高 。

android.os.Build.MODEL :獲取手機(jī)的型號 設(shè)備名稱。如果發(fā)現(xiàn)Landroid/os/Build;-MODEL 為sdk,則為模擬器上運(yùn)行。

安卓模擬器玩法教程都是什么

1、安卓模擬器BlueStacks新版本App Player采用名為Layercake的技術(shù),可以讓針對ARM處理器開放的安卓應(yīng)用運(yùn)行在基于x86處理器的PC或者平板上,而且可以調(diào)用PC的顯卡,能提供比Alpha版本更加平滑的體驗(yàn)。

2、點(diǎn)擊逍遙安卓的設(shè)置 在設(shè)置界面點(diǎn)擊,高級,并將設(shè)備設(shè)置為XIAOMI MI 5或者OnePlus 3T。這兩種型號都支持《王者榮耀》高幀率模式,點(diǎn)擊保存后重啟模擬器。

3、以微信搖一搖為例:第一步:進(jìn)入微信搖一搖,搖一搖快捷鍵是Ctrl+0。第二步:點(diǎn)擊模擬器右側(cè)工具欄中的操作助手功能。第三步:點(diǎn)擊開始按鈕就會開啟錄制腳本。

如何判斷Android設(shè)備是真機(jī)還是模擬器

但是,基于真實(shí) 硬件 的API由于 模擬器 本身的限制是不能被模擬出來的,因此應(yīng)用但凡需要調(diào)用這些API的,都應(yīng)該選擇 真機(jī) 調(diào)試。一般項(xiàng)目中,可以使用宏定義來判斷模擬器還是真機(jī),這無疑是有效的。

測試光傳感器。一般的按住設(shè)備都有光線傳感器,模擬器是沒有的。測試CPU類型。手機(jī)是arm架構(gòu),模擬器基本是intel和amd兩種。

設(shè)備1:4df78680771b117b 設(shè)備2:OBAI5HDQZPDIRCQG 模擬器:unknown 3,android_id String android_id = Secure.getString(getContentResolver(), Secure.ANDROID_ID);設(shè)備和模擬器都有,16位。

android.os.Build.MODEL :獲取手機(jī)的型號 設(shè)備名稱。如果發(fā)現(xiàn)Landroid/os/Build;-MODEL 為sdk,則為模擬器上運(yùn)行。

當(dāng)前文章:android模擬器判斷 安卓模擬器實(shí)現(xiàn)原理
網(wǎng)頁鏈接:http://muchs.cn/article31/dgdeipd.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供網(wǎng)站設(shè)計(jì)、網(wǎng)站維護(hù)、ChatGPT商城網(wǎng)站、網(wǎng)站建設(shè)、品牌網(wǎng)站建設(shè)

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

成都seo排名網(wǎng)站優(yōu)化